Description

For Separating Ball Joints, Tie Rods, Pitman Arms and Other Uses. Six tools in one for exceptional versatility and value. Kit consists of three forks and two handles; one for hammering, the other for use with an air hammer (. 401" shank). All forks are threaded to interchange with either handle. Forks are heavy-duty forgings, handles are heat-treated alloy steel.

  • Now this, is a pickle fork kit.
After buying and returning the GRIP set, I ordered these. What a difference. This set is night and day better than the other. Handles screw in straight, casting marks are mostly ground away, and the shank for the air hammer actually fits like it's supposed to. Well worth the money to get this kit over the other. Very satisfied. As a side note, on the back of the package label, it indicates that the end of each handle (or hammer adapter) has a point at the end which drives the tool, rather than driving by the threads. This should prevent thread deformation under high impact. Very nice touch. ... show more

  • Rough and ready
Not used in anger yet but seem okay, more of there if needed tool for me. Casting quality is not bad and much better than some I have seen. The conincal base on the shafts means that the forces is NOT transmitted via the thread which is good. The pnematic hammer shaft fits my generic hammer okay. As a side note there is a debate if pickle forks are good to use, generally they can damage the joint so best to replace. Use a bolt type UJ splitter if you have to re-use parts. ... show more

  • Works like a charm
As a Technician I see a lot of cars, as a Technician in a snow state, rust makes a simple job harder. Replacing tie rods or anything with a joint is no match. Due to rust this joints can become very well seized, If replacement is needed with a new one then I use my air hammer with appropriate size and the joint comes loose in an instant. Turns lengthy difficult jobs into easy ones. I would recommend it to anyone dealing with suspension work. Do not use if you plan on reusing joint, A puller would save the grease boot from damage. ... show more
